Speaking in the House of Commons on 17 June 2026

Debate

Mental Health: Parity of Esteem

Contribution

My hon. Friend was a champion for mental health long before I came to this House, and I congratulate her on securing the debate. She makes a point about spending, and I read this morning that despite 28% of cases in the NHS being related to mental health, it receives only 13% of the funding. That is at the same time that parity of esteem has been a legal requirement for over a decade. If we are serious about parity of esteem between physical and mental health, the spending must follow the rhetoric.
